Indian Rupee Falls to 95.38 Against US Dollar Amid Rate Hike Expectations

The Indian Rupee declined by 20 paise to close at 95.38 against the US dollar on July 6, 2026, as the US dollar strengthened. Market participants are pricing in one rate hike this year, contributing to the rupee's depreciation. Earlier in the day, the rupee fell 10 paise to 95.28 in early trade. On July 3, the rupee had appreciated by 17 paise to close at 95.18 against the US dollar.

NIA Names Hafiz Saeed and LeT, TRF in Pahalgam Terror Attack Chargesheet

The National Investigation Agency (NIA) has named Lashkar-e-Taiba (LeT) founder Hafiz Saeed as an accused in the Pahalgam terror attack. The chargesheet details Pakistan's conspiracy and Saeed's involvement, supported by evidence collected by the NIA. Both LeT and its front group, the Terrorist Rehabilitation Foundation (TRF), have been charged as legal entities for their roles in planning, facilitating, and executing the attack.

Allahabad HC directs Centre, ASI to respond on Tejo Mahalaya temple claim

The Allahabad High Court has asked the central government and the Archaeological Survey of India (ASI) to file a counter-affidavit in response to a public interest litigation (PIL) claiming that the Agreshwar Mahadev Nagnatheswar Virajman Tejo Mahalaya temple exists within the Taj Mahal premises. The petition seeks official recognition of the temple's presence inside the Taj Mahal complex. The court's directive aims to address the dispute surrounding the historical and archaeological status of the site.

Decline in Exclusive Breastfeeding Rates Despite Maternal Health Improvements in India

Despite improvements in institutional deliveries, women's empowerment, and maternity programmes in India, exclusive breastfeeding rates have declined. NFHS-6 data reveal persistent gaps in postnatal support, workplace protection, and maternity benefits, which contribute to this decline. Medical, social, and economic factors are identified as key contributors to the reduced rates of exclusive breastfeeding among Indian mothers.

Digital Survey Begins for Thammanam–Pullepady Road Project in Kerala

The long-overdue digital survey for the Thammanam–Pullepady Road project in Kerala has commenced. The project aims to construct a 3.7-kilometer-long four-lane road that will link MG Road with the Edappally–Vyttila NH 66 Bypass. This will be achieved by widening and extending the existing Thammanam–Pullepady Road, improving connectivity in the region.

FIFA World Cup 2026 Begins with Record 48 Teams

The FIFA World Cup 2026 commenced with a record 48 teams, the highest number in the tournament's history. These teams were divided into 12 groups of four, playing a total of 72 matches in the group stage. Following these matches, the number of teams qualifying for the knockout stage was reduced to 32. The tournament continues with these teams competing through subsequent rounds leading up to the final match for the trophy.

Haaland's Brace Sends Norway to Historic FIFA World Cup 2026 Quarterfinals

In the FIFA World Cup 2026 Round of 16 match, Norway defeated Brazil 2-1, with Erling Haaland scoring both goals for Norway. Haaland's sixth and seventh goals of the tournament helped Norway qualify for the quarterfinals for the first time in their history. His performance in this match also brought him level with Lionel Messi and Kylian Mbappe in the tournament's top scorers list. Brazil was unable to respond effectively, resulting in their elimination from the competition.

Norway Eliminates Brazil in FIFA World Cup 2026 Round of 16

In the FIFA World Cup 2026 Round of 16 match, Norway defeated Brazil with Erling Haaland scoring twice. Norway's goalkeeper Nyland made crucial saves to deny Brazil's attempts to score. Prior to the match, Brazil was wary of Norway and Haaland, having never beaten Norway in four previous meetings, including a 2-1 loss at the 1998 World Cup.

Ali Khamenei Funeral Held in Tehran with Three Brothers Present

The funeral of Ali Khamenei took place at Tehran's Grand Mosalla religious complex on July 5, 2026. The event was one of the largest public gatherings in Iran since the deaths of Khamenei and four family members in Israeli airstrikes on February 28, which were reportedly based on US intelligence. Notably, Mojtaba Khamenei was absent from the funeral, while three of his brothers attended to pay their final respects.
